Commerce In Tagalog – English To Tagalog Translations

Commerce can be translated as “Kalakalan, Negosyo, Pangangalakal, or Kalakal” or the Tagalized “Komersiyo”. Here are some example sentences translated from English to Tagalog:

  • Unfortunately, the Internet is not merely used to spread beneficial information, culture, and commerce.
  • He threw out of the temple those who were using it for commerce
  • Peter wanted to learn more about commerce because his father was a businessman.
  • We need commerce because it connects the producers and consumers.

In Tagalog, these sentences can be translated as:

  • Nakalulungkot, ang Internet ay hindi lamang ginagamit upang maghatid ng kapaki-pakinabang na impormasyon, kultura, at komersiyo.
  • Pinalayas niya mula sa templo ang mga gumagamit nito para sa pangangalakal
  • Gusto ni Peter na mag-aral pa tungkol sa komersiyo dahil businessman ang kanyang ama.
  • Kailangan natin ng komersiyo dahil ito ang nagpapalapit sa mga konsumer at produser.
